  • Page 10: Swivel

    Swivel With the built-in base, you can tilt and rotate the monitor to get the best viewing angle� Height Adjustment To adjust the height, the user needs to press or lift the monitor� 155mm Monitor Pivot - Adjust the screen position before rotating the monitor screen� (Make sure that the monitor screen ascent to its highest point, and it inclines backward at 23�5°�) - then rotate clockwise /counter clockwise until the monitor stops at 90°�...

  • Page 13: Speaker

    Speaker Your monitor has embedded a pair of speaks with 3W, and it can support DP or HDMI audio output and USB audio output� The USB cable need plug in when you use USB audio channel (picture2)� DP or HDMI audio output doesn’t need USB cable but DP or HDMI cable (picture 1)� Picture 1 Picture 2 Picture 1...

  • Page 19: Windows Hello Setup (Windows 10)

    Windows Hello setup (Windows 10) Note: To set up “Windows Hello”, do the following: 1� Press “Windows” + “I” and then click Accounts, choose “Sign-in options”� 2� Setup PIN number� 3� Establish face-recognition by clicking Set up, Get started� 4� Scanning your face information and enable face-recognition to unlock your computer� Chapter 1�...

  • Page 28: Selecting A Supported Display Mode

    Selecting a supported display mode The display mode of the monitor uses is controlled by the computer� Therefore, refer to your computer documentation on how to change display modes� The image size, position and shape might be changed when the display mode changes� This is normal and the image can be re-adjusted using automatic image setup and the image controls�...
  • Page 29 Understanding power management Power management is invoked when the computer recognizes that you have not used your mouse or keyboard for a user-definable period� There are several states as described in the table below� For optimal performance, switch off your monitor at the end of each working day, or whenever you expect to leave it unused for long periods during the day�...
